Best TVs 2019: TV shopping is always a tricky business, and with plenty of options out there you need the best advice to sort the wheat from the chaff. So what’s the best TV that suits your needs?

CES took place in Las Vegas earlier this year and a number of cool TVs were showcased there. Samsung’s 75-inch MicroLED is not likely to bother consumers or retailers this year, but LG’s 4K OLEDs, Panasonic’s GZ2000 OLEDs and Sony’s A9G TVs are coming in next few months.
